The pericycle is a cylinder of parenchyma or sclerenchyma cells that lies just inside the endodermis and is the outer most part of the stele of plants. Although it is composed of non-vascular parenchyma cells, it's still considered part of the vascular cylinder because it arises from the procambium as do the … See more The pericycle is located between the endodermis and phloem in plant roots. In dicot stems, it is situated around the ring of vascular bundles in the stele. See more In dicot roots, the pericycle strengthens the roots and provides protection for the vascular bundles. WebOct 24, 2024 · Pericycle It is a single-cell layer lying internal to the endodermis. It consists of small, thin-walled parenchyma cells with abundant protoplasm. 5. Conjunctive Tissue It is a mass of parenchyma cells lying in between the xylem and phloem bundles. 6. Pith It occupies the central portion of the root and consists of parenchymatous cells. WebPericycle is the outermost layer of the stele and innermost layer of the endodermis. It is made up of cylinder parenchymatous or sclerenchyma cells. Lateral roots are endogenous in nature. They are originated from the pericycle. The Pericycle is present in both monocot and dicot roots and absent in monocot stem. pulsar ebay freezes my computer

WebEncircling the conducting tissues is a meristematic layer called the pericycle. This single cell layer is responsible for producing lateral roots. Unlike root hairs which emerge on the outside of the root ( exogenous, exo- meaning outside), lateral roots emerge from the internal tissues ( endogenous, endo- meaning inside).

WebPericycle is a very important layer. A part of the vascular cambium is formed by the pericycle. The cork cambium also develops from it. All lateral roots originate from the pericycle. Pericycle is absent in the roots of some aquatic plants and parasites. Dicot Root: Part # 5.
